Default Please help. 2000 stratus fuel pump

My pump will not come on unless I hot wire it. If I turn the key, pump will not come on and no voltage is supplied to harness behind rear seat.

I have replaced dist and crankshaft sensor. Still no pump. all fuses and relays checked. I have move piston #1 to TDC and checked the right cam sprocket. Its right on. The left sprocket on my 2.5 v6 is giving me trouble getting the cover off. Do I really need to check alignment on that sprocket also? Is it possible that the left sprocket slipped?

Can a ROV suddenly fail causing my pump to shut off? I am at wits end and dont want to take it to a garage because I dont think they will diagnose it relative quickly.

What else can cause the pump to stop?

Default

have you tried replacing fuel pump relay and autoshutdown relay with different ones from distridution center ,also when your checking for power is someone doing key or are you turning it on then going to back to check it "The PCM controls the fuel pump relay by switching the ground path for the solenoid side of the relay on and off. The PCM turns the ground path off when the ignition switch is in the Off position. When the ignition switch is in the On position, the PCM energizes the fuel pump If the crankshaft position sensor does not detect engine rotation, the PCM de energizes the relay after approximately one second "

Yes I swapped relays for fuel pump and ASD.

I have someone in the rear listening while I turn on the key.

I realize that PCM shuts off pump, injectors and coil if no signal is received from cam shaft or crank shaft, thats why I replace both of them...needlessly.

What about roll over valve? What about ignition switch? What about left cam sprocket skipping the belt?
